Requirements

  • High school graduate or equivalent (GED)
  • Ability to read, write, comprehend, and interpret documents
  • Basic mathematical skills
  • Suggestive Selling/Knowledge of Products (preferred)
  • Bilingual (preferred)

Responsibilities

  • Assist in leading day-to-day activities of department operations in a retail store, ensuring associates are trained, department is fully staffed, operating at company standards, and meeting company goals and key performance indicators
  • Properly cut all types of meats into various cuts and prepare related products according to company and department standards to contribute to the store's financial best interests
  • Order and maintain inventory in the department using inventory control procedures to ensure product freshness and quality
  • Cut and weigh steaks, chops, etc., for individual servings
  • Review and validate received orders for amount, quality, count or weight, condition, and store all product in appropriate areas
  • Assist Department Manager in managing a team that completes stocking, production, and additional tasks to ensure product quality, production planning, accuracy, and date-sensitive rotation; handle spoiled/damaged products per guidelines
